Wall Waterproofing Questions
What is wall waterproofing? Wall waterproofing involves applying barriers or sealants to prevent water from penetrating basement or foundation walls, helping to keep interiors dry.
What types of projects benefit from wall waterproofing? Basement leaks, foundation cracks, and areas prone to moisture buildup are common projects that benefit from waterproofing services.
How does wall waterproofing help property owners? It reduces the risk of water damage, mold growth, and structural issues caused by moisture infiltration.
What surfaces can be waterproofed? Interior and exterior foundation walls, basement walls, and retaining walls are typically suitable for waterproofing treatments.
